Weight cutting is such a loophole that it's mind boggling they allow it. Majority of fighters couldn't even make the next weight class up without cutting....thats how ridiculous it is.

Why are we so up and arms about fighters taking drugs that enhancement their performance when you have guys doing dangerous things like dehydrating themselves in order to circumvent the entire point of weight class which is to match fighters of similar size against each other. You're basically having 2 dangerous outcomes with weight cutting. 1.) A fighter can die doing it. 2) You are potentially putting one person with a significant size advantage against another person.
